VENPCC1H ; IHS/OIT/GIS - MORE ENCOUNTER FORM DATA MINING ;
Source file <VENPCC1H.m>
| Package | Total | Call Graph | 
|---|---|---|
| PCC New Encounter Form | 2 | (CSPOV,MH,POV,PROB)^VENPCC1K ($$CFG,$$CP,$$FVICD,$$GP,$$MAXNARR,$$PRV)^VENPCCU | 
| VA Fileman | 2 | (,C)^%DTC $$GET1^DIQ | 
| Kernel | 1 | $$FMTE^XLFDT | 
| Outpatient Pharmacy | 1 | SIG^PSOHELP |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| SORT | ||
| DX(PRV,DFN) | ; EP-GET PREFERRED DIAGNOSES | |
| REVLIST | ||
| REFILL(SIG,RXIEN) | ; EP-APPEND REFILL INFO TO SIG | |
| MED(PRV,DFN) | ; EP-GET RECENT MEDS | |
| POV | ; ADD POVS TO THE LIST | |
| CLASSIC | ; EP-LEGACY Rx LIST FORMATTING | |
| PROB(DFN) | ; EP-GET ACTIVE PROBLEMS | |
| REM(RXIEN) | ; EP-GET INFO FROM PRESCRIPTION FILE: REMARKS, ISSUE DATE AND PRESCRIBING PROVIDER | |
| RXVAR | ; SET GLOBAL RX VARIABLES | |
| ADD | ||
| CLASS(DFN) | ; EP-GIVEN A DFN, RETURN THE PATIENT CLASS FOR USER PREFERENCES | |
| RXCK | ||
| SIG(SIG) | ; EP-GET EXPANDED SIG | |
| NEWREM | ||
| RXLIST | ; FINAL PASS: CREATE THE (SORTED) MAIL MERGE NODES | |
| MLOOP | ||
| MAXMSG | 
| Name | Field # of Occurrence | 
|---|---|
| ^%DTC | MLOOP+15 | 
| C^%DTC | MLOOP+16 | 
| $$GET1^DIQ | REM+10 | 
| SIG^PSOHELP | MLOOP+17, SIG+4 | 
| CSPOV^VENPCC1K | POV+17 | 
| MH^VENPCC1K | POV+18 | 
| POV^VENPCC1K | POV+16 | 
| PROB^VENPCC1K | PROB+1 | 
| $$CFG^VENPCCU | RXVAR+2 | 
| $$CP^VENPCCU | DX+4 | 
| $$FVICD^VENPCCU | POV+9 | 
| $$GP^VENPCCU | DX+5 | 
| $$MAXNARR^VENPCCU | PROB+3 | 
| $$PRV^VENPCCU | REM+13 | 
| $$FMTE^XLFDT | PROB+11, REM+6 | 
| FileNo | Call Tags | 
|---|---|
| ^PSRX - [#52] | GET1^DIQ |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^AUPNPROB - [#9000011] | PROB+6, PROB+10 | 
| ^AUPNPROB("AC" | PROB+5 | 
| ^AUPNVMED - [#9000010.14] | MLOOP+1 | 
| ^AUPNVMED("AA" | MLOOP | 
| ^AUPNVPOV - [#9000010.07] | POV+5 | 
| ^AUPNVPOV("AC" | POV+4 | 
| ^AUPNVSIT - [#9000010] | MLOOP+5 | 
| ^AUTNPOV - [#9999999.27] | PROB+9, POV+8 | 
| ^DD("DD" | MLOOP+12 | 
| ^DD(52 | MLOOP+18 | 
| ^DPT - [#2] | CLASS+2 | 
| ^ICD9 - [#80] | PROB+9, POV+10 | 
| ^PS(55 - [#55] | RXCK+4 | 
| ^PSDRUG - [#50] | MLOOP+8 | 
| ^PSRX - [#52] | RXCK+3, REFILL+2, REFILL+3, REM+3, REM+5, REM+10, REM+12 | 
| ^PSRX("APCC" | RXCK | 
| ^VA(200 - [#200] | REM+14 | 
| ^VEN(7.1 - [#19707.1] | DX+4, DX+5, DX+6, DX+7 | 
| ^VEN(7.41 - [#19707.41] | PROB+1, PROB+4, PROB+10, PROB+16, RXVAR+3, RXVAR+4, RXVAR+9, RXVAR+11, RXVAR+13, MLOOP+2 , MLOOP+15, RXCK+3, RXLIST+12, REM+3, REM+4, REM+10, REM+11 | 
| ^VEN(7.5 - [#19707.5] | RXVAR+13, MLOOP+17 | 
| Name | Line Occurrences | 
|---|---|
| $$CLASS | DX+2 | 
| $$REFILL | NEWREM+1 | 
| $$REM | NEWREM | 
| $$SIG | MLOOP+17 | 
| ADD | RXCK+1 | 
| CLASSIC | RXLIST+12 | 
| NEWREM | RXCK+4 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| % | DX+1~, PROB+2~, PROB+10*, PROB+11, POV+2*, POV+3, MED+3~, MLOOP+5*, MLOOP+6, MLOOP+7 , MLOOP+15*, REVLIST+1*, REVLIST+2*, REVLIST+3, REM+5*, REM+6 | 
| AGE | CLASS+1~, CLASS+5*, CLASS+6, CLASS+7, CLASS+9, CLASS+10 | 
| >> CFIGIEN | RXVAR+2*, RXVAR+13, MLOOP+17 | 
| CHM | MED+2~ | 
| CHMFLG | MED+3~, MLOOP+19*, RXCK+4*, ADD+3*, SORT | 
| CKCM | MED+3~, RXVAR+11*, RXVAR+12*, RXVAR+13*, RXVAR+14, RXCK+5 | 
| CNT | MED+3~, RXLIST+7*, RXLIST+8 | 
| DATE | MED+1~, MLOOP+6*, MLOOP+12, MLOOP+15, MLOOP+16 | 
| DAYS | MED+1~, MLOOP+4*, MLOOP+15, MLOOP+16 | 
| DCD | MED+1~, MLOOP+3* | 
| >> DEFEF | PROB+1, PROB+3, PROB+4, PROB+10, PROB+16, RXVAR+3, RXVAR+4, RXVAR+9, RXVAR+11, RXVAR+13 , MLOOP+2, MLOOP+15, RXCK+3, RXLIST+12, REM+3, REM+4, REM+10, REM+11 | 
| >> DEPTIEN | DX+4, PROB+1, POV+17 | 
| DFLG | REM+1~, REM+4*, REM+7 | 
| DFN | DX~, DX+2, PROB~, PROB+1, PROB+5, POV+4, POV+16, POV+17, POV+18, MED~ , MLOOP, RXCK+4, CLASS~, CLASS+2 | 
| DIEN | DX+1~, DX+6*, DX+7 | 
| DOB | CLASS+1~, CLASS+2*, CLASS+3, CLASS+5 | 
| DT | MLOOP+15, MLOOP+16, CLASS+5 | 
| EXP | MED+2~ | 
| EXT | MED+1~, MLOOP+12*, MLOOP+13, SORT, RXLIST+11*, REVLIST+2, CLASSIC+2, REM+7*, REM+8* | 
| FVFLAG | PROB+2~ | 
| GENERIC | DX+1~ | 
| >> HDR25 | POV+15, RXVAR+16 | 
| ICD | DX+1~, DX+7*, DX+10, PROB+2~, PROB+9*, PROB+14, POV+9*, POV+13 | 
| ICD9 | PROB+2~ | 
| ICD9( | PROB+9*, POV+6, POV+7* | 
| IDT | MED+2~, RXVAR+1*, MLOOP* | 
| IIEN | DX+1~, PROB+2~, PROB+6*, PROB+7, PROB+9, POV+5*, POV+6, POV+7, POV+10 | 
| INDX | DX+1~, DX+3*, DX+4*, DX+5*, DX+6 | 
| INS1 | SIG+1~, SIG+5*, SIG+6 | 
| ISDT | REM+1~, REM+6*, REM+7, REM+8 | 
| MAX | PROB+2~, PROB+4*, PROB+12, POV+1, POV+11, MED+2~, RXVAR+3*, MAXMSG | 
| MAXNAME | MED+3~, RXVAR+6*, REVLIST+2, CLASSIC+3 | 
| MAXNARR | PROB+2~, PROB+3*, PROB+14, POV+13 | 
| MAXREM | MED+3~, RXVAR+8*, REVLIST+2, CLASSIC+6, REM+11, REM+18 | 
| MAXRX | MED+3~, RXVAR+5* | 
| MAXSIG | MED+3~, RXVAR+7*, REVLIST+2, CLASSIC+5 | 
| MED | MED+1~, MLOOP+8*, MLOOP+9*, MLOOP+10, MLOOP+11*, MLOOP+12, SORT, RXLIST+10*, REVLIST+2, CLASSIC+3 | 
| MIEN | MED+1~, MLOOP*, MLOOP+1, RXCK | 
| MODE | REM+1~, REM+11*, REM+15, REM+16 | 
| NAME | DX+1~, DX+7*, DX+8*, DX+10 | 
| NARR | PROB+2~, PROB+9*, PROB+11*, PROB+14, POV+8*, POV+10*, POV+13 | 
| NIEN | PROB+2~, PROB+6*, PROB+7, PROB+9, POV+5*, POV+8 | 
| NTRX | MED+1~, MLOOP+1*, MLOOP+9 | 
| PASS1 | MED+3~ | 
| PASS1( | SORT*, RXLIST+7, RXLIST+8 | 
| PASS1(0 | MAXMSG*, RXLIST+2, RXLIST+4 | 
| PASS1(1 | RXLIST+2*, RXLIST+3*, RXLIST+4* | 
| PER | MED+2~, MLOOP+15* | 
| PIEN | PROB+2~, PROB+3*, PROB+5*, PROB+6, PROB+10, POV+4*, POV+5, POV+9 | 
| PRV | DX~, DX+3, MED~ | 
| PTYPE | DX+1~, DX+2*, DX+3, DX+4, DX+5 | 
| QTY | MED+1~, MLOOP+4*, SORT, RXLIST+10*, REVLIST+2, CLASSIC+4 | 
| RED | MED+2~ | 
| REF | MED+2~, REFILL+1~, REFILL+2*, REFILL+3*, REFILL+4 | 
| REM | MED+2~, MLOOP+4*, NEWREM*, SORT, RXLIST+10*, REVLIST+2, CLASSIC+6, REM+1~, REM+2*, REM+3* , REM+10*, REM+11, REM+18*, REM+19 | 
| RIEN | MED+1~, MLOOP+1*, MLOOP+2, MLOOP+8, ADD+2 | 
| RXHDR | MED+3~, RXVAR+10*, RXVAR+14*, RXVAR+15*, RXVAR+16 | 
| RXIEN | MED+3~, RXCK*, RXCK+1, RXCK+3, RXCK+4, NEWREM, NEWREM+1, REFILL~, REFILL+2, REFILL+3 , REM~, REM+3, REM+5, REM+10, REM+12 | 
| RXP | REM+1~, REM+12*, REM+13*, REM+14 | 
| RXSORT | MED+3~, RXVAR+9*, RXVAR+14*, ADD+3, RXLIST+1 | 
| SCAT | MED+1~, MLOOP+7*, MLOOP+11 | 
| SEX | CLASS+1~, CLASS+2*, CLASS+3, CLASS+8 | 
| SIG | MED+1~, MLOOP+4*, MLOOP+17*, MLOOP+18*, NEWREM+1*, SORT, RXLIST+10*, REVLIST+2, CLASSIC+1*, CLASSIC+5 , SIG~, SIG+2, SIG+3, SIG+5, REFILL~, REFILL+2, REFILL+4*, REFILL+5 | 
| SORT | MED+3~, RXLIST+7*, RXLIST+8 | 
| STAT | PROB+2~, PROB+6*, PROB+7, MED+2~ | 
| STG | MED+3~, RXLIST+8*, RXLIST+10, RXLIST+11, REVLIST+1, CLASSIC+1 | 
| STOP | DX+2*, PROB+2~, PROB+5, PROB+12*, POV+4, POV+11*, MED+1~, MLOOP!, MAXMSG* | 
| >> TMP | DX+10, DX+12, PROB+14, POV+3, POV+13, MED+4, RXVAR+16, MLOOP+2, ADD+2, REVLIST+3 , REVLIST+4, REVLIST+6, CLASSIC+2, CLASSIC+3, CLASSIC+4, CLASSIC+5, CLASSIC+6 | 
| TOT | DX+1~, DX+6*, DX+9, PROB+2~, PROB+3*, PROB+12*, PROB+13, POV+1, POV+2*, POV+3 , POV+11*, POV+12, MED+1~, RXVAR+1*, ADD+1*, MAXMSG, SORT, RXLIST+6*, RXLIST+9*, REVLIST+3 , REVLIST+4, CLASSIC+2, CLASSIC+3, CLASSIC+4, CLASSIC+5, CLASSIC+6 | 
| TXT | REM+1~, REM+15*, REM+16*, REM+17*, REM+18 | 
| TYPE | PROB+2~, PROB+6*, PROB+7 | 
| U | DX+7, PROB+1, PROB+4, PROB+6, PROB+9, PROB+10, PROB+16, POV+5, POV+10, RXVAR+3 , RXVAR+5, RXVAR+6, RXVAR+7, RXVAR+8, RXVAR+9, RXVAR+11, RXVAR+13, RXVAR+15, MLOOP+1, MLOOP+2 , MLOOP+3, MLOOP+4, MLOOP+6, MLOOP+7, MLOOP+8, MLOOP+15, MLOOP+17, RXCK+3, RXLIST+12, REFILL+2 , REM+3, REM+4, REM+5, REM+10, REM+11, REM+12, REM+15, REM+16, CLASS+2 | 
| VAR | DX+1~, DX+9*, DX+10, PROB+2~, PROB+13*, PROB+14, POV+12*, POV+13, MED+1~ | 
| VAR1 | DX+1~, DX+9*, DX+10, PROB+2~, PROB+13*, PROB+14, POV+12*, POV+13 | 
| VIEN | MED+1~, MLOOP+4*, MLOOP+5 | 
| X | DX+1~, DX+7*, PROB+2~, PROB+6*, POV+5*, MED+2~, RXVAR+4*, RXVAR+5, RXVAR+6, RXVAR+7 , RXVAR+8, RXVAR+11*, RXVAR+12, RXVAR+13, RXVAR+15, MLOOP+1*, MLOOP+3, MLOOP+4, MLOOP+15, MLOOP+16 , MLOOP+18*, SIG+1~, SIG+3*, REFILL+1~, REFILL+3*, REM+1~, REM+14*, REM+15, REM+16, CLASS+1~ , CLASS+2* | 
| X1 | MED+2~, MLOOP+15*, MLOOP+16* | 
| X2 | MED+2~, MLOOP+15*, MLOOP+16* | 
| Y | MED+2~, MLOOP+12*, REM+1~, CLASS+1~, CLASS+8*, CLASS+9, CLASS+10, CLASS+11 | 
| Z0 | MED+2~ | 
| Z1 | MED+2~ | 
| Name | Field # of Occurrence | 
|---|---|
| $T(PROB^VENPCC1K | PROB+1 | 
| $T(SIG^PSOHELP | MLOOP+17 |